Evolution of Online Casinos: A Tech-Driven Journey
In the early 2000s, online casinos were a novelty—rudimentary sites offering a handful of slot games and basic card tables. Fast forward to 2025, and the industry now supports cloud-based gaming ecosystems, integrated wallets, and seamless mobile compatibility.
Key developments have included:
- HTML5 technology, which replaced Flash, enabling responsive, cross-device play.
- Mobile-first design, catering to smartphone-dominant users globally.
- Live dealer technology, blending traditional casino play with high-definition streaming.
These upgrades haven’t just improved usability—they’ve opened up new ways to attract, retain, and entertain players around the world.

Game Mechanics Meet Machine Learning
The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ning has created smarter gaming environments that adapt to user behavior. Online casinos now use algorithms to analyze player preferences and present more tailored experiences—whether it’s recommending specific games, adjusting difficulty levels, or offering real-time bonuses.
Some standout uses of AI in the casino industry include:
- Dynamic game personalization based on player habits and session history.
- Fraud detection through anomaly monitoring in betting patterns.
- Chatbot support systems for 24/7 customer service and onboarding.
This data-driven approach not only enhances gameplay but also boosts retention by making each session feel uniquely engaging.
Gamification: Making Gambling More Interactive
Gamification has become a powerful trend across digital platforms, and online casinos are no exception. Through reward systems, leaderboards, missions, and progression bars, platforms turn casual gaming into a continuous adventure.
Popular gamification techniques in the casino space include:
- Daily challenges that reward users with free spins or tokens.
- Loyalty tiers where players unlock perks as they level up.
- Mini-games and side quests integrated within larger casino ecosystems.
This approach taps into psychological drivers like achievement and competition, making sessions more interactive and increasing user engagement beyond traditional betting.
Blockchain and Smart Contracts in iGaming
Blockchain is emerging as a disruptive force across industries, and iGaming is a key area of experimentation. By removing the need for intermediaries, blockchain enables transparent, provably fair games where outcomes can be verified on-chain.
Smart contracts add another layer of innovation. These self-executing codes handle payouts and bonuses without human intervention, eliminating errors or delays.
Here’s a snapshot of blockchain benefits for online casinos:
Feature | Benefit |
Provably fair games | Verifiable randomness ensures fair outcomes |
Crypto payments | Faster, secure, and borderless transactions |
Smart contracts | Automated winnings and bonus distribution |
Decentralized apps | No single point of failure or control |
These technologies also reduce operational costs, enabling platforms to pass savings back to players through higher payout ratios or more generous bonuses.
Augmented and Virtual Reality: A New Dimension
The push for immersive gameplay has led some forward-thinking casinos to experiment with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R). By blending real-world environments with digital overlays, AR casinos provide players with a hybrid experience—one that feels physical yet remains digital.
VR, on the other hand, goes even further by transporting users into entirely virtual casino worlds. Imagine putting on a headset and walking into a luxurious lobby, choosing a seat at a poker table, and chatting with players from across the globe—all from your living room.
Although still in early stages, AR and VR integration offers:
- Realistic casino ambiance, replicating the look and feel of physical spaces.
- Interactive interfaces, allowing players to pick up chips or spin reels with hand gestures.
- Social presence, mimicking real-life interactions through avatars and voice chat.
As hardware becomes more affordable and mainstream, AR/VR casinos are poised to redefine user engagement in online gambling.
Secure Payments and Digital Wallet Integration
One of the most critical components of the online gambling experience is financial security. Traditional banking methods, while reliable, often come with delays and fees. To counter this, modern casinos now support a variety of digital wallets and crypto assets for instant, low-fee transactions.
Popular integrations include:
- Bitcoin, Ethereum, and stablecoin support for international accessibility.
- Two-factor authentication (2FA) for enhanced account protection.
- Instant withdrawal options with no manual review delays.
Players now expect the same level of convenience and transparency from their casino transactions as they do from fintech apps—pushing platforms to continually optimize backend systems for speed and trust.
